Jan Rauberg is a scholar working on Astronomy and Astrophysics, Molecular Biology and Oceanography. According to data from OpenAlex, Jan Rauberg has authored 30 papers receiving a total of 1.1k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 27 papers in Astronomy and Astrophysics, 25 papers in Molecular Biology and 8 papers in Oceanography. Recurrent topics in Jan Rauberg’s work include Ionosphere and magnetosphere dynamics (25 papers), Geomagnetism and Paleomagnetism Studies (25 papers) and Solar and Space Plasma Dynamics (17 papers). Jan Rauberg is often cited by papers focused on Ionosphere and magnetosphere dynamics (25 papers), Geomagnetism and Paleomagnetism Studies (25 papers) and Solar and Space Plasma Dynamics (17 papers). Jan Rauberg collaborates with scholars based in Germany, China and United States. Jan Rauberg's co-authors include Claudia Stolle, H. Lühr, Ingo Michaelis, Guram Kervalishvili and Jaeheung Park and has published in prestigious journals such as Geophysical Research Letters, Geophysical Journal International and Hydrology and earth system sciences.
